ROLES OF TRAVEL AGENCIES
& TOUR OPERATORS
Tour & Travel Management
Travel Agency
■ Is a type of business that acts as intermediary or middleman between the tourism
products’ and the tourist/travelers
■ Main functions of the travel agency is to market and promote all types of tourism
products and services
■ Is considered as one of the essential businesses in the tourism industry
Tour Operator
■ Is an organization, firm, or company that buys travel components
individually and combines them into a package tour that can be sold
to the direct customers or through tourism channel
■ Also known as the manufacturers of tourism products and services as
they are responsible for delivering and performing all the products and
services included in the packaged tour they offer to their customers
■ Is one who has the responsibility of putting the tour ingredients
together, marketing it, making reservations, and handling actual
operation

Difference Between Travel Agency and
Tour Operator
Travel Agency
•Acts like an independent reseller and receives commissions for the sale of the
tour operator’s package
•Small to medium enterprise
•Acts as the distributor/reseller of the tourism products
•Deals with one component of travel products
Tour Operator
•Purchases travel components from different suppliers, forms a single tourist
product, and sells them using its own pricing
•Usually large companies
•Acts as the supplier or manufacturer of tourism products
•Offers a variety of tour programs

Retail Travel Agency
■ Acts as resellers of tourism products and services
■ Sells products and services directly to the tourists and receive
commissions from the suppliers as their income
Wholesale Travel Agency
■ Purchase travel components in bulk from suppliers, assemble tour
packages, and sell them to the tourists through retail travel agencies

Types of Tour Operators
■ Inbound Tour Operators
■ Outbound Tour Operators
■ Domestic Tour Operators
■ Ground Operators
Inbound Tour Operators
■ Receive tourists in the host country and handle all their land
arrangements
■ Based locally, and offer local destinations, attractions, events, and
other services to the tourist
Outbound Tour Operator
■ Promote tours for foreign destinations
■ Normally worked with international travelers and offer specialized tour
packages in a particular country or region
Domestic Tour Operators
■ Creates and assemble travel components into all-inclusive tours and
market them to domestic travelers
Ground Operators
■ Organizes and arrange tours for incoming tourists on behalf of
overseas operators
■ Make sure that the entire travel in the destination is in accordance
with the package tours or arrangements the tourists have with the
overseas operators
